The V36 Skyline carries more mass over its multi-link rear axle than the R34 it replaced, and that extra weight is exactly what shows up as rear-end wander once you start stringing together fast laps rather than fast straights. XYZ Racing’s Circuit Master coilover for the Nissan SKYLINE V36 (Modified Rr Integrated) (2006-2014) is built around that reality: a set-up aimed at sustained circuit lap-time work rather than a single quick blast down a B-road.
XYZ built this kit around three external adjustment knobs feeding 9720 combinations of damping, giving you enough range to chase a genuinely different balance session to session rather than nudging within a narrow band. The same damper architecture has done duty with XYZ’s own racing squads on circuits worldwide, so the adjustment range on this kit isn’t a lab exercise – it has been proven under racing conditions first.
What this coilover does for your 2006-2014 Nissan SKYLINE V36 (Modified Rr Integrated)
Fitted to the V36’s rear multi-link geometry, the modified rear units bring the back axle into line with what the front end is doing under trail-braking, cutting the rear-steer feel that stock rear dampers let build up as track temperatures rise. The 9720-way adjustment range spread across three knobs means you can run a softer, more compliant setting for a bumpy circuit like Cadwell and switch to a stiffer platform for a smoother, faster track like Snetterton without swapping parts. Ride height drops with the lowered spring perches, pulling down the V36’s centre of gravity and tightening body control through direction changes that the factory GT-tuned suspension was never asked to manage. Because the range is genuinely wide, you are not locked into one compromise setting – the same kit can be run loose for a wet trackday and tightened up for a dry qualifying session.
About the Circuit Master coilover
Circuit Master sits at the top of XYZ Racing’s range, built specifically for competition use rather than road comfort. Construction centres on a damper body with three external adjustment knobs and a claimed 9720 possible combinations, giving racers on tarmac rally and drift-spec builds the same fine-grained control this kit brings to the V36. XYZ has run this damper through its own racing teams on circuits internationally, using that track mileage to refine the valving rather than relying on bench testing alone. One quirk worth knowing: the small oil-hole design inside each knob can produce a faint noise when the damper compresses hard over kerbs or bumps mid-lap. That is a function of the passage size, not a fault, and it does not affect damping performance – XYZ designed the unit around circuit surfaces, where this is a non-issue rather than something to worry about on track.
